Gorilla Experiment Builder incident
Disruption to content loading
Gorilla Experiment Builder experienced a notice incident on July 30, 2024 affecting Gorilla Platform, lasting 3h 24m. The incident has been resolved; the full update timeline is below.

Update timeline
- identified Jul 30, 2024, 12:28 PM UTC
Azure (our cloud service provider) are experiencing issues with their CDN (Content Delivery Network) and associated services. As we use Azure's CDN to stream task/questionnaire assets such as image/videos etc. as well as some core definition/manifest files within the tooling, some tasks/questionnaires and experiments are now failing to load. Stimuli failing to load or tasks/questionnaires failing to load with the No-Mani-1 error are symptomatic of this issue. - monitoring Jul 30, 2024, 02:56 PM UTC
Now that sufficient access to Azure has returned, we've deployed a code change to temporarily remove the affected services from our workflow. Task/Questionnaires and Experiments should now function correctly (though may take slightly longer to load than normal!) We're continuing to monitor the issue, to make sure no other problems arise!
- resolved Jul 30, 2024, 03:53 PM UTC
While the wider issues with Azure persist, our fixes to circumvent the affected resources (Azure CDN's) seems to have worked as desired! Once the main issue on Azure is resolved, we'll reinstate the CDN's, which should bring stimuli load times back down to normal levels!
